TP6 0多應用模式隱藏路由中的應用名

2021-10-08 15:28:06 字數 823 閱讀 4908

本文預設採用的是多應用模式

1. 多應用模式中隱藏路由中的應用名的三種方式

2. 網域名稱繫結應用

// 網域名稱繫結(自動多應用模式有效)

'domain_bind'

=>

['*'

=>

'index'

,'liang'

=>

'admin'

],

假設根網域名稱為tp.cy, 此時訪問二級網域名稱liang.tp.cy自動訪問 admin 應用

3. 增加應用入口

複製public/index.php,另存為public/admin.php

訪問網域名稱/admin.php預設訪問 admin 應用下的 index控制器 index方法

也就是入口檔名對應預設訪問的應用(index.php 除外,其他入口檔名都會自動對應各自的應用)

4. 入口檔案繫結應用

將入口檔案的以下內容

);修改為以下內容(將入口檔案繫結到 admin 應用)

ThinkPHP6 0多應用路由規則

index 主應用 controller 控制器目錄 model 模型目錄 view 檢視目錄 config 配置目錄 route 路由目錄 更多類庫目錄 admin 後台應用 controller 控制器目錄 index.php 控制器類 model 模型目錄 view 檢視目錄 config 配...

TP6 安裝和多應用模式部署

安裝前準備 tp6提供了兩種版本安裝方式,這裡我們選擇穩定版本進行安裝 composer create project topthink think chat安裝完成後,cd到chat目錄下執行 php think run這裡執行成功後 直接訪問http localhost 8000 就可以訪問成功...

Tp6安裝以及多應用模式設定

修改.htaccess檔案,隱藏index.php 注意 修改的是public目錄下的.htaccess檔案 rewritecond d rewritecond f rewriterule index.php 1 q sa,p t,l rewr iter ule 1 qsa,pt,l rewrite...